Plantations are playing an increasingly important part in the development and the economies of the South. This book examines the rationale and purpose of plantations in forestry and development, showing up the misconceptions and myths that have surrounded their role, analysing the problems they present and describing the contribution they can make - when properly planned and managed - to sustainable development. The conditions appropriate for both simple and complex plantations are described; together with an analysis of the challenges typically presented by complex plantations.
